Address:
601 Elmwood Ave SUITE 651, Rochester 14642
(585) 275-7787 (Phone), (585) 461-3614 (Fax)
STRONG MEMORIAL HOSPITAL
601 Elmwood Ave SUITE 655, Rochester 14642
(585) 275-2100 (Phone), (585) 473-3516 (Fax)
Certifications:
Pediatrics, 1998, Perinatal Medicine & Neonatal Medicine, 2012
Hospitals:
601 Elmwood Ave SUITE 651, Rochester 14642
STRONG MEMORIAL HOSPITAL
601 Elmwood Ave SUITE 655, Rochester 14642
Strong Memorial Hospital
601 Elmwood Ave, Rochester 14642
Education:
Medical School
University of Rochester
Graduated: 1987
Strong Mem Hsp University Rochester